Benefits of DL-Methionine for Liver Health and Detoxification

DL-Methionine is an essential amino acid that plays a vital role in liver health and detoxification. Research indicates it aids in reducing liver fat accumulation. A study revealed that methionine deficiency can lead to liver damage and increased fatty liver disease. Therefore, ensuring adequate intake is crucial for optimal liver function.

Additionally, DL-Methionine supports detoxification processes. It helps in the synthesis of glutathione, a powerful antioxidant. Glutathione is essential for neutralizing free radicals and detoxifying harmful substances in the liver. A report from the Journal of Nutritional Biochemistry highlights that DL-Methionine supplementation can increase glutathione levels significantly in individuals with liver conditions.

While the benefits of DL-Methionine are clear, the need for a balanced approach is necessary. Excessive intake can lead to negative effects, such as elevated homocysteine levels, which is linked to cardiovascular issues. Monitoring consumption is key. Individuals should work with health professionals to assess their needs carefully. A tailored plan ensures both the health of the liver and overall well-being.

Recommended Dosages and Safety Profile of DL-Methionine Supplementation

DL-Methionine is essential for health. It's an amino acid that supports various bodily functions. Recommended dosages vary widely among individuals. A common supplement dose ranges between 500 to 1500 mg each day. Some studies suggest higher doses may be beneficial, but safety remains a priority.

The safety profile of DL-Methionine is often favorable. However, excessive intake can lead to side effects. Reported issues include gastrointestinal discomfort and increased homocysteine levels. High homocysteine can pose cardiovascular risks, which raises important questions about dosage and long-term use.

Monitoring is crucial when supplementing with DL-Methionine. Regular consultations with healthcare providers can help individuals adjust their intake safely.
